I just read Don Box's Languages and Beauty Contests post and was surprised to see him praising the aesthetic value of VB.NET.

Am I mistaken or has the collective self-esteem of millions of VB.NET programmers just risen considerably?

Perhaps the word 'just' is a bit of a stretch since the post was actually written several weeks ago. I would have come across it sooner, but I am currently living in mortal fear of my RSS Reader which has somehow managed to swell in size to a couple of hundred subscriptions and now spends all of my computer's spare CPU cycles calculating evil plots to take over the world. But I digress...

For those of you who have never worshiped at the alter of Don, here are his wiki-street creds. Besides being one of the original designers of SOAP, he's also authored of a few books in the DevelopMentor "Essential" series that I wasn't quite smart enough to fully grok the last time I tried reading them. If you've been around long enough to have had the pleasure of working with COM, then you probably recognize the "COM is Love" phrase that he coined.

To put it in historical context, he was a full-fledged geek rock-star when Ayende was still busy popping zits.

Back in the .NET beta days when I was still fairly new to the industry, I was lucky enough to have the opportunity to attend a DevelopMentor sponsored .NET conference that he led. Don had the unbeatable combination of being scary smart, extremely articulate, and wildly charismatic in front of crowds (at least by tech standards). If I remember correctly, he also seemed to have a cult following of wide-eyed tech groupies who hung on his every word. I was obviously a little awe struck by him myself.

He was also a self-avowed CSharpophile with deep C++/Java roots. I'm sure I heard him poke fun at his fellow DevelopMentor cohort, Ted Pattison, who was the premier VB guru of the day.

Now you understand my surprise at his post. It is sort of like the most popular kid in school suddenly putting the moves on the 300 pound pimply band chick with braces that walks around mumbling to herself.  Having him pick VB.NET as the Language beauty contest winner was just... well ...unexpected.

So move over Ruby, a new long-legged programming language super model is in town. Let the creepy code crushes and disturbing language lust begin!
Comments on this post: Look Who's Got a Language Crush!

# re: Look Who's Got a Language Crush!
Remember that this is the guy that unleashed SOAP on the world and has a bizarre angle bracket fetish. I'm not too sure I'd be taking his sense of aesthetics too seriously.
Left by Jeremy on Dec 06, 2007 8:42 PM

# re: Look Who's Got a Language Crush!
@Jeremy - Congratulations! By the power of google I hereby bequeath you the soon-to-be famous phrase "angle bracket fetish". It sounded so perfect that I figured I would get a million hits on it, but I came up with zilcho. I'm sure it's been said a million times, but reality is google and google is reality so it's officially all yours. Too bad you can't collect royalties on phrases because I plan to fit this one in every conversation I can from now on.

By the way, if VB.NET is the 300 pound pimply faced band girl, then what does that make XML?
Left by Russell Ball on Dec 06, 2007 10:57 PM

